You reach Bagdogra Airport, the closest airport to Sikkim. You are transferred to Gangtok, the scenic capital of Sikkim, a distance of about 4 to 5 hours. On your drive through the winding roads, the scenery of green green valleys and hills of the Eastern Himalayas will be stunning. Once you arrive in Gangtok, you can check-in to the hotel and spend your evening at leisure. You can take a stroll along MG Road, the center of Gangtok's market place, and enjoy hill station weather by having a hot cup of tea and looking through some local handicrafts.
You can have a proper breakfast, and then go for Gangtok's sightseeing for a day. The day will start with the famous Rumtek Monastery, one of the biggest Sikkim Buddhist monasteries. The monastery is well known for its serene atmosphere and Tibetan architecture. Then visit Tsomgo Lake, a glacial lake at an altitude of over 12,000 feet. The lake is ringed by snow-capped mountains and offers scintillating landscapes, and thus it is a wonderful destination for nature lovers. Another must-visit site is a tour to Baba Harbhajan Singh Temple, which is in honor of a soldier who lost his life in the area. The temple is one of the holiest sites of worship for the locals. The final destination to visit will be Do Drul Chorten Stupa, a serene Buddhist stupa that gives a wide-angle view of Gangtok. Day three starts with breakfast, and thereafter, we drive to Pelling, a quaint town of West Sikkim district, 5-6 hour drive from Gangtok. Famous for its stunning vistas of Kangchenjunga, Pelling is one of the best places in Sikkim to witness panoramic mountain views. After check-in at your Pelling hotel, the day is free. During the evening, you can take a leisurely walk around town, enjoying the cool breeze and surrounding landscape. Pelling's serene atmosphere is perfect for unwinding after an exhausting drive.
Today, your Pelling sightseeing will visit some of Sikkim's most popular destinations. Start the day by visiting Khecheopalri Lake, a holy lake ringed with dense forests. It is ranked among the holiest of lakes in Sikkim, and its peaceful charm is interesting. The second visit should be to the Pemayangtse Monastery, one of the oldest and holiest monasteries in Sikkim. The monastery is a serene place to meditate and offers breathtaking views of the surrounding mountains. Next visit the Rabdentse Ruins, the remains of the former capital of the Kingdom of Sikkim. The ruins offer great insight into the history of Sikkim, as well as great views of the Himalayan ranges. Lastly, visit Singshore Bridge, the tallest suspension bridge in Sikkim, which has great views of the ravines. After the day's sightseeing, return to your hotel to relax.

Darjeeling, the "Queen of the Hills," is a mixture of nature landscape and colonial structures. Start the day early by going to Tiger Hill, one of the most sought-after viewpoints that offers a breathtaking view of the sunrise over the Kangchenjunga range. After witnessing the sunrise, head to Batasia Loop, a strange railway loop on which the Darjeeling Himalayan Railway (Toy Train) operates. Then, visit the Peace Pagoda, a stunning Buddhist pagoda with great views of Darjeeling. Next, visit the Padmaja Naidu Himalayan Zoological Park, which has several rare species, the red panda among them. The last place for the day would be the Jorpokhri Wildlife Sanctuary, a good destination to go green. The last day of your tour is the day when you drive to Kalimpong, which is roughly 2-3 hours away from Darjeeling. Kalimpong is renowned for its peaceful beauty, vibrant bazaars, and Buddhist monasteries. Upon reaching Kalimpong, you will be visiting the Zang Dhok Palri Phodang Monastery, which is renowned for its scenic backdrop. Then, go to the Durpin Dara Hill to get a bird's eye view of the town and the landscape. You can also visit the Kalimpong Flower Nurseries, which are renowned for their variety of exotic flowers.
